Identify the incorrect statement.

Options

  1. AThe reaction of C ₆ H ₅ CH ₂- CHCl - C ₆ H ₅ with alc. KOH on heating yields two products.
  2. BWhen (-)-2-bromooctane is reacted with aqueous KOH , the substitution follows S _ N 2 mechanism and product fo
  3. CBenzylic halides show higher reactivity towards S_N 1 reaction.
  4. DOptically active (-)-2-Methylbutan-1-ol on reaction with HCl yields a product (+) -1-Chloro-2-methylbutane.

Correct answer

B. When (-)-2-bromooctane is reacted with aqueous KOH , the substitution follows S _ N 2 mechanism and product fo

Step-by-step solution

(1) Correct: Dehydrohalogenation of C₆H₅CH₂-CHCl-C₆H₅ with alc. KOH gives stilbene ( C₆H₅-CH=CH-C₆H₅ ), which exists as two geometric isomers (cis and trans) — hence two products. (2) Incorrect: S_N2 involves Walden inversion. Reaction of (-) -2-bromooctane with aqueous KOH via S_N2 gives (+) -octan-2-ol (inverted configuration), not (-) -octan-2-ol. (3) Correct: Benzylic halides readily undergo S_N1 because the benzylic carbocation intermediate is stabilised by resonance with the benzene ring. (4) Correct: Reactio
